Dave Barnes Headlines Upcoming Ryman Concert

Dave Barnes

Seasoned singer-songwriter Dave Barnes, who released his ninth studio album Carry On, San Vicente on Friday, March 18th, will perform at the Ryman Auditorium on July 23rd as the headlining act. This is the first time Barnes has headlined a show at the Ryman.

Barnes received GRAMMY® and CMA nominations for Best Country Song for his #1 song “God Gave Me You” as recorded by Blake Shelton. Barnes also recently co-wrote a song with Kelsea Ballerini called “Symphony” which was debuted at Tin Pan South.

Carry On, San Vicente was written by Barnes and co-produced with Ed Cash (Vince Gill, Dolly Parton, Amy Grant) and marks a new sound for the Nashville native who describes the album as a tip of the hat to Laurel Canyon in the 70s with a ton of influences from that era including The Eagles and Fleetwood Mac. Highlights of Carry On, San Vicente include the up-tempo album opener “She’s The One I Love” that Barnes wrote to emanate the 70s; “Nothing Like You” and “Glow Like the Moon,” with soaring harmonies and catchy lyrics these tracks will have fans singing along; and “Need Your Love,” which truly encapsulates the sound that The Eagles are so well known for and will be a standout track for any fan. Barnes has solidified his foothold in the music community over the last fourteen years not only with his music amassing an impressive following with fans, media and even fellow artists calling out his undeniable talent but also working with some of the biggest names in music. He has headlined several sold out tours across the country and has opened for artists including Bonnie Raitt, Taylor Swift, John Mayer, Jonny Lang, Lady Antebellum and One Republic. He has written/co-written songs for artists including Hunter Hayes (“Young & in Love”), Tim McGraw (“Mary & Joseph”), Billy Currington (“Until You”), Terri Clark (“Don’t Start”), Ben Rector (“You and Me”), Kelly Clarkson, Marc Broussard, Matt Wertz, The Josh Abbott Band, Danielle Bradbery and Andrew Ripp. His songs have been featured in movies (“Employee of the Month,” “My Super Ex-Girlfriend”) and TV (ABC’s “Brothers and Sisters,” WB’s “Summerland,” CW’s “Life Unexpected,” Disney’s “Suite Life On Deck,” and Showtime’s “Dexter,” which also featured part of the music video).
